Hi there,

I just finished a 12 player game and came third. The elo adjustment page shows me as losing Elo against 5 players, marking each as a defeat. I was only defeated by two other players.

Can this please be explained?it was this game

haha, nice catch. It looks like for the Elo scoring the results aren't put in numerical order but in alphabetical order.

So, as a third place, you lost against 1,2,10,11,12, as they all are before 3 alphabetically. [in the same vein, 10 won against 11,12,2,3,...,9]

I'd guess that isn't as it should be and so should be reported as a bug. I have no idea though if that is a bug related to the game or to the whole of bga

it gets even worse:

the break down of Elo change for places 10,11,12 show that same behaviour ("won" against 2,3,...) and it also shows how the Elo should've changed with that.

But as opposed to the Elo loss for 2nd, 3rd, etc place that the system still keeps in place, here we have different behaviour: The Elo gain is nullified.
Looks like someone saw the bug and instead of fixing it completely they made some manual adjustments to Elo scoring.
Thus obfuscating the real bug
